在Debian系统中,如果你想要释放一个已经分配给网络接口的IP地址,你可以使用dhclient
命令。以下是具体步骤:
确定要释放IP地址的网络接口:
首先,你需要知道你想要释放IP地址的网络接口名称。你可以使用ip addr
或ifconfig
命令来查看当前的网络接口及其IP地址。
ip addr show
或者
ifconfig -a
释放IP地址:
假设你要释放的网络接口是eth0
,你可以使用以下命令来释放其IP地址:
sudo dhclient -r eth0
这个命令会通知DHCP服务器释放当前分配给eth0
接口的IP地址。
重新获取IP地址(可选): 如果你想要重新获取一个新的IP地址,可以使用以下命令:
sudo dhclient eth0
这个命令会向DHCP服务器请求一个新的IP地址并分配给eth0
接口。
sudo
。如果你是通过静态IP配置的网络接口,配置文件通常位于/etc/network/interfaces
。例如:
auto eth0
iface eth0 inet static
address 192.168.1.100
netmask 255.255.255.0
gateway 192.168.1.1
dns-nameservers 8.8.8.8 8.8.4.4
如果你想要释放静态IP地址并重新配置,你需要编辑这个文件,然后重启网络服务:
sudo nano /etc/network/interfaces
修改或删除相关的静态IP配置,保存并退出编辑器。
然后重启网络服务:
sudo systemctl restart networking
或者使用以下命令重启特定的网络接口:
sudo ifdown eth0 && sudo ifup eth0
这样,你就可以释放并重新配置网络接口的IP地址了。